ΙΙ — The Problem
What we're solving.
Most AI search tools are lazy. They take your question, find text that shares similar keywords, and have an AI write an answer from that. In academia, law, and medicine, that's fatal. It ignores how important a paper actually is: it will treat a 1990 abandoned hypothesis the same as a 2024 breakthrough with a thousand citations, simply because the keywords matched.
People don't want more papers. They want to know how a paper fits: what it's next to, what it disagrees with, what it actually explains. Literature should feel explorable, not exhausting.
ΣΦΑΛΜΑ — What We Got Wrong
The first version was a single hardcoded pipeline built for academic papers only. Adding a second domain meant forking the whole codebase, and every future domain would need its own fork forever. We rebuilt the core to be domain-agnostic, then proved it by running legal case-law retrieval on the same engine, not a copy of it.
ΙΙΙ — Where It Stands
Told straight, no jargon.
CiteWeave answers the question every researcher asks at one in the morning: where does this paper actually sit in the field? Give it a paper, and instead of a list of similar-sounding results, it hands you a map. What it builds on, what disagrees with it, what's genuinely new about it.
The engine behind that map is real and running. It doesn't just match keywords. It follows actual citation trails, and it pulls real sentences out of papers' "what we couldn't figure out" sections instead of guessing at gaps.
Today it's an engine, not an app. There's no web interface yet, you'd need to be a developer to query it directly. That's the next thing to build, and we'd rather build the right interface than the fast one.
